    The Big Dipper is a star that we are very familiar with. It is located in the northern sky and consists of seven stars, shaped like a bucket used to scoop wine in ancient China, so it is called the Big Dipper.

    What are the names of the seven stars that make up the Big Dipper? Also from the end of the bucket body to the end of the bucket handle are Tianshu, Tianxuan, Tianji, Tianquan, Yuheng, Kaiyang, and Shaoguang. The details are shown in the figure below.

    So what kind of stars are the Big Dipper? Who are they bigger than the sun? Let's start with the first star of Doukou, Tianshu, and introduce them one by one.

    The Celestial Pivot is located approximately 124 light-years from Earth. It is the farthest of the Big Dipper from Earth. Tianshu is the second brightest star in the Big Dipper, with an apparent magnitude.

    The mass of the Tianshu is four times that of the Sun, with a diameter of about 44.54 million kilometers, which is also 32 times the diameter of the Sun. It is more than 30,000 times larger than the Sun. So the Celestial Pivot is an expanding orange giant star with a surface temperature of about 4400, which is much lower than that of the Sun.

    It has come to the end of its life.

    Sky Swirl is the second star from Doukou. It is located about 79 light-years away from Earth. The magnitude is bright.

    Sky Swirl is a main-sequence star with a mass 3 times that of the Sun, a diameter of about 2 times that of the Sun, and a surface temperature of about 9500. Its surface temperature is much higher than that of the sun.

    Dimensity is the third star from the Doukou. It is located about 83 light-years from Earth. Magnitude brightness.

    The mass of the celestial star is 3 times that of the Sun, and the radius is also 3 times that of the Sun. Its surface temperature is about 9000. It is a main-sequence star much larger than the Sun.

    Tianquan Star is also known as Composition Quxing in ancient China. It is located about light-years away from Earth. The magnitude of the star is bright, and it is the faintest star of the Big Dipper.

    The mass of Tianquan is times that of the sun, the radius is times that of the sun, and the surface temperature is about 8600 9800. The planet Celestial Power is slightly larger than the Sun.

    Yuheng is the first star in the Big Dipper. It is located about light-years away from Earth. It is the brightest star of the Big Dipper. The mass of Yuheng is about 3 times that of the sun, the radius is about 4 times that of the sun, and the surface temperature is about 8700.

    Kaiyang is the second star of the Big Dipper, which is also called "Wuqu Star". It is located about light-years away from Earth. The magnitude is equal in brightness. It has 2 times the mass and radius of the Sun.

    Yaoguang is the star at the very end of the Big Dipper. It is located about 104 light-years from Earth. Yaoguang regards the magnitude of the star as.

    It has 6 times the mass of the Sun and a radius about twice that of the Sun. It is a blue main-sequence star with a very high surface temperature of about 14000 to 16000. Scientists have observed that the age of Yaoguang Star is only about 10 million years old.

    The above are some basic facts about the seven stars of the Big Dipper. Of the seven stars, the Celestial Pivot is the farthest and largest from Earth. Yaoguang is the most massive star with the highest surface temperature.

    Kaiyang is the closest one to the earth. Tianquan is the smallest star. However, even the smallest celestial power is larger in mass and volume than the sun.
